Output ef253b14b3498950e0e68c72c88a91ee98110329bbcedaa90f526c23cf1dca4a: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ae01679c615ca208a984866bee5227a199760c10 OP_EQUAL
address
3HZ5BXNz4G3urs4Xy9tgwHy9wG1UTsdnFL
transaction
ef253b14b3498950e0e68c72c88a91ee98110329bbcedaa90f526c23cf1dca4a
spent
true